Ballistic experts to probe seized ANVC-B bombs, AOC blast

TURA: Meghalaya Police will be handing over to ballistic experts the crude bombs which were reportedly seized from the ANVC-B camp at Daren Agal after a gun battle on Saturday last and also evidence from the AOC petrol pump blast site to check for similarities, if any, between the two.

Police sized nine crude bombs, each weighing five kg, from the Daren Agal camp of the outfit hours after a bomb ripped through on a road next to AOC petrol pump, Tura, damaging two vehicles.

While a nascent militant outfit A’chik Tiger Force (ATF) had claimed responsibility for the blast, police are not taking chances.

“We will go by the report of the ballistics experts and see whether there is any connection between the two incidents,” said the DGP.

He added that the experts will investigate to ascertain the materials used in the device that exploded at AOC petrol pump and others recovered from Daren Agal.
